My research considers the influence of the biosphere on geological processes such as erosion and sedimentation, and also the tectonic evolution of the Earth. The evolution of life is strongly influenced by external factors, among them, plate tectonic (break down of continents) and climate change (green-world or ice-world), mantle convection (degassing of deep plume through hot spot), and meteoritic impacts. Is the life important enough to modify any of these geological events ? Can we speak of a co-evolution of life and geological processes, such as the marine sedimentation, the erosion of continent or the global climate ? Could we be witnessing (pre anthropogenic influence) and participating to a global biological war for survival, with large ecosystems (biome) or a single species in the case of homo sapiens controlling the environment, such as global climate, to their advantage ?
Answering these questions is not an easy job and ongoing debates are still on the front scene, nearly 4 decades after the provocative idea of GAIA (the full planet Earth reacts as a living organism) proposed by James Lovelock and more than 150 years after the birth of the Darwinism. This work includes field studies and takes advantage of classical (major and trace elements, H-, O-, C-,N- & S-isotopes, radiogenic Sr-, Nd, Pb-isotopes) and new geochemical tracers affected by the biological cycle, such as Mg- and Ca-isotopes.
